Mitochondrial DNA and inflammatory proteins are higher in extracellular vesicles from frail individuals.

Anjali M ByappanahalliNicole Noren HootenMya VannoyNicolle A ModeNgozi EzikeAlan B ZondermanMichele Kim Evans
Published in: Immunity & ageing : I & A (2023)
These data suggest that mtDNA within EVs may act as a DAMP molecule in frailty. Its association with chemokines and other inflammatory EV cargo proteins, may contribute to the frailty phenotype. In addition, the social determinant of health, poverty, influences the inflammatory cargo of EVs in midlife.
